Solution Overview

Problem

Existing foundation garments lack flexibility in providing customizable compression and shaping support, as they typically offer uniform compression across the body without the option to adjust based on specific areas of focus or user preference.

Innovation Solution

A garment design featuring an outer fabric with movable inner compression panels that can be positioned independently to provide targeted compression and shaping support to different body areas, allowing users to customize the level and location of compression based on their needs.

Solution Approach 1:

The garment is divided into distinct panels with different compression characteristics. The outer fabric and inner fabric are separated into movable panels that can be independently positioned, allowing different sections of the garment to provide different levels of compression based on user needs.

Solution Approach 1:

The connection between panels uses movable joints or flexible attachments that allow panels to be repositioned dynamically. This enables users to adjust compression locations by moving panels to different positions while maintaining the structural integrity of the garment.

Inventive Principle:
Principle #15Dynamics

Solution Approach 2:

Inner fabric panels are positioned within or attached to the outer fabric in a nested arrangement that allows independent movement. The panels can slide or adjust relative to each other, providing flexibility in positioning compression zones without compromising the overall garment structure.

AI summary

A garment includes an outer fabric of a first material and an inner panels of a second material. The inner panels are attached to the outer fabric in a way that allows them to be moved towards a front and a back of the garment. For example, the inner panels are movable related to each other and the outer fabric.
